Energize your future by joining our team at Northern Virginia Electric Cooperative (NOVEC)! NOVEC's mission is to create value for its members, employees and communities by providing safe, reliable electricity and quality products at competitive prices.
NOVEC is a locally owned electric distribution system headquartered in Manassas, VA. NOVEC provides reliable electric service to more than 180,000 homes and businesses in Clarke, Fairfax, Fauquier, Loudoun, Prince William and Stafford counties, the City of Manassas Park, and the Town of Clifton. NOVEC's service reliability is the best in the region with a 99.99% average system reliability.
As a leader on the high-tech frontier, NOVEC is using proven, cost-effective technology to improve productivity and reliability, reduce expenses, and increase cybersecurity – a national priority. Today’s technology includes what the industry calls "smart grid", as well as fiber optics, and mobile workforce.

We are seeking a data-driven and customer-focused Customer Experience (CX) Operations Analyst to join our team. In this role, you will analyze customer feedback, operational performance data, and customer touchpoints to identify trends, uncover pain points, and recommend actionable insights to enhance the end-to-end customer experience. Your work will directly contribute to building stronger partnerships, improving satisfaction, and driving continuous improvement across the organization. This position collaborates closely with customer care, billing, metering, field services, operations, and IT teams to enhance customer satisfaction and operational efficiency.

- Analyze customer service metrics (e.g., response time, satisfaction scores, surveys, complaints, ticket volume) to identify performance trends and improvement opportunities.
- Develop and maintain dashboards and reports that provide clear and actionable insights to stakeholders.
- Collaborate with customer operations teams and other stakeholders to provide analytical support for projects and initiatives.
- Support the VoC program by systematically collecting, analyzing, and acting on customer feedback. Develop processes for tracking and responding to customer complaints and inquiries.
- Translate customer insights into actionable recommendations for product, marketing, and service improvements.
- Provide impact analysis and user feedback to support the rollout of new tools, platforms, or process changes.
- Assist in documenting and updating standard operating procedures (SOPs) and customer workflows.
- Participate in cross-functional projects to improve end-to-end service delivery.
